Context: Why This Moment Matters Fan tokens are the ultimate expression of fandom turned financialized. They give holders voting rights on minor club decisions, exclusive merch discounts, and a dopamine hit when the team scores. But make no mistake: their value is 100% narrative-driven. $ARG is not a DeFi protocol with yield sources. It is not a Layer 1 with a roadmap. It is a digital flag that flies high when Argentina wins and crumples when they lose.

The World Cup Final is the peak of that narrative. Every crypto-native fan, every speculator, every bot farmer is watching. The match day surge is predictable—I’ve seen it with $POR during Portugal’s Euro run, with $BAR during el Clásico. But this time, the market context is sideways consolidation. Bitcoin is chopping between $68K and $72K. Altcoins are bleeding. In such an environment, the only liquidity moves toward events that promise immediate action. $ARG becomes the perfect trap: a shiny hook in a dead pond.

First, the volume explosion is concentrated on Binance and Bybit. Over the past 12 hours, $ARG/USDT perpetuals saw open interest rise 300%. That’s not organic buying; that’s leveraged speculation. The funding rate flipped positive to 0.05% per hour—meaning longs are paying to stay in. In a sideways market, that’s a recipe for a squeeze. But the direction could be either way: a goal by Argentina sparks a short squeeze; a Spanish counter-attack triggers a long squeeze.

Second, on-chain data tells me that the top 10 wallets hold 68% of the token supply. These are not fans; they are insiders or early investors who bought at cents during the 2022 launch. One of those wallets, which I flagged in my real-time spread monitor during the 2024 ETF arbitrage era, moved 5 million $ARG to Binance exactly two hours before the bus left for the stadium. Classic insider signal. I’ve seen this pattern since the 2017 ICO days—whales always front-run the narrative.

Third, the bid-ask spread on the $ARG/USDT pair widened to 0.3%—ten times higher than normal. That tells me market makers are pulling liquidity. They know the post-match drop is coming. The chart whispers about the game; the volume screams about the exit.
